System size resonance (SSR) was observed in binary attractor neural networks. The network

Area of Science:

  • Computational neuroscience
  • Complex systems

Background:

  • System size resonance (SSR) describes optimal system response at a specific finite size.
  • Binary attractor neural networks are models of associative memory.

Purpose of the Study:

  • To investigate SSR phenomena in binary attractor neural networks.
  • To analyze network response to external stimuli.

Main Methods:

  • Analytical calculations.
  • Computer simulations.
  • Studied network in the ferromagnetic phase.

Main Results:

  • Demonstrated SSR in binary attractor neural networks.
  • Observed signal amplification dependent on network size.
